James A. Fitzpatrick sends the Technicolor cameras under the supervision of William Steiner to Callendar in Ontario to shoot this short about the Dionne Quintuplets, the first set of quintuplets to survive and catalogue the small but steady stream of tourists who came to gawk at them.
Hollywood made a minor industry of them. Jean Hersholt played their doctor in a feature, which became a series of B pictures as Doctor Christian, a role which he also played on the radio and television until his death in 1956.
Two of the quntuplets, Annette and Cecile, are still alive at the time I write this. The copy of this Traveltalk which plays occasionally on Turner Classic Movies is in very good condition.
